It began small in 2007 as a day to honor the remaining vinyl record shops across the country, and much like Comic Con, it has grown exponentially over the last decade. Find your favorite record store, and take advantage of some great deals this Saturday. I'm a 45 rpm guy, but it's really much more of an LP thing. There's Princeton Record Exchange and Jack's (in Red Bank) to name but a couple. Happy Record Store Day to you - and many more.
